#533675 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#533675 is composed of 32.5% red, 21.2%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 267.6 degrees, a saturation of 36.8% and a lightness of 33.5%. #533675 color hex could be obtained by blending #a66cea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#533675 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#533675 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#533675 has RGB values of R:83, G:54,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 5453429.

Shades and Tints of #533675
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07040a is the darkest color, while #fcf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#533675
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#55505b is the less saturated color, while #4f01aa is the most saturated one.
